Output 628b17ddd91c1921f7b213e0dfc1699dfb585e85a1d249eec06b40d318c73339:1

value
699650
script pubkey
OP_0 OP_PUSHBYTES_20 089f8a7ffbd3c492889e5beb21e6ced8419f7bc7
address
bc1qpz0c5llm60zf9zy7t04jrekwmpqe777807dm5y
transaction
628b17ddd91c1921f7b213e0dfc1699dfb585e85a1d249eec06b40d318c73339
confirmations
806
spent
false